Here's some more "fun" to share with everyone.
Had an insurance claim a few years ago.
Helped owner maximize the claim with their insurance company. Interestingly, insurance companies have flat amounts for just about everything, based upon zip codes.
Once owner got their funds, they proceeded to nickel & dime us for every and any bid item we gave them. All our prices were UNDER what the insurance company paid, and they still weren't low enough.
So, owner went and hired someone to do the work cheaper than us.
3 months later they called us to take over and the job was a mess. Their cheap guy took their money and did only half the work, which was shoddy at best.

Hi Stephen, you state "required extensive maintenance and upgrades" , required by who? Were these discussed between you and your PM? If so, maybe they mistook the conversation as authorization?
We never do any repairs or upgrades without crystal clear discussion and authorization from our owners. I would recommend just contacting them and be as open as you were here and have a discussion on what transpired, why and where any confusion came in from either side.
